With a population of 167 people, Bosworth has 90 motor vehicles based on the Australian Bureau Of Statistics 2021 Census. This is made up of 46 homes with 1 motor vehicle, 25 homes with 2 motor vehicles, and 19 of homes with 3 motor vehicles or more.
